Nestled along the Mid-Atlantic coastline, Maryland, known as the "Old Line State" and the "Free State," offers a dynamic blend of history, diverse landscapes, and a thriving urban scene. With its proximity to major cities like Washington, D.C., and Baltimore, Maryland plays a crucial role in the political, economic, and cultural tapestry of the United States.

Annapolis, the state capital, is a historic city with cobblestone streets and colonial architecture. It is home to the United States Naval Academy, where future naval officers are trained, and the Maryland State House, which served as the nation's first peacetime capital.

Baltimore, Maryland's largest city, stands as a vibrant urban center with a rich maritime heritage. The Inner Harbor, a historic seaport, features attractions like the National Aquarium, historic ships, and waterfront restaurants. Baltimore's cultural scene includes the Baltimore Museum of Art, the Walters Art Museum, and the iconic Fort McHenry, the birthplace of the U.S. national anthem.

The state's diverse landscapes range from the sandy shores of the Chesapeake Bay to the mountainous terrain of the Appalachian region in Western Maryland. The Chesapeake Bay, the largest estuary in the United States, plays a central role in Maryland's identity, offering opportunities for boating, crabbing, and enjoying scenic waterfront views.

Maryland is also known for its commitment to education and research institutions, including the University of Maryland and Johns Hopkins University. The state's proximity to the nation's capital contributes to its significance in scientific research, technology, and government affairs.

Cultural diversity thrives in Maryland, with communities reflecting a mix of influences. The state's culinary scene is celebrated for its seafood, particularly blue crabs, and iconic dishes like Maryland crab cakes and Old Bay-seasoned delicacies.
